Roman Reigns Stretchered Out Of WWE Clash In Paris
By Conor Renshaw on 1 September 2025
Following his win against Bronson Reed at WWE’s Clash in Paris pay-per-view yesterday, Roman Reigns was taken out of the arena on a stretcher.
Reigns defeated Reed to open the show last night in a match that went over 20 minutes, and Reigns confronted Paul Heyman and demanded that he return his shoes that Reed had stolen from him on the July 28 and August 4 episodes of Raw. Heyman gave Reigns back the shoes, and then Reigns attacked Heyman and put him in a chokehold before celebrating atop the announcer’s desk.
However, Bron Breakker then entered to deliver a spear to Reigns and put him through the announcer’s table, and as Reigns was being helped to the back, Breakker ran down the entrance ramp and speared Reigns again. Bronson Reed then got involved and delivered a Tsunami Splash to Reigns, and as Breakker and Reed helped Heyman to the back, medics strapped Reigns to a stretcher, but Reed then delivered more Tsunami’s to Reigns whilst he was strapped to the board.
Jey Uso then came out to attempt to save Reigns, but was met with a spear by Breakker as well. Michael Cole later announced on commentary that if either Reed or Breakker returned to the building, they would be suspended from the company.
Why Is WWE Seemingly Doing An Injury Angle With Roman Reigns?
This angle with Roman Reigns being stretchered out of the building by medics is seemingly an injury angle that will give WWE an excuse to write him off TV for a while. The reason for this is widely believed to allow Reigns time travel to Australia to begin filming for the upcoming Street Fighter movie, which began principal photography in Australia on August 18.
Reigns has been cast in the movie as the villain Akuma, which in Japanese means “Devil” or “Demon”, and first appeared in the Street Fighter video game series in Street Fighter II Turbo as a secret character and is the younger brother of Gouken, who is Ryu and Ken’s master.
